Abstract
Building recognition is an important task for a wide range of computer vision applications, e.g., surveillance and intelligent navigation aid. However, it is also challenging since each building can be viewed from different angles, under different lighting conditions, etc, resulting in a large variability among building images. A number of building recognition systems have been proposed in recent years. However, most of them are based on a complex feature extraction process. In this paper, we present a new building recognition model based on local oriented features with an arbitrary orientation. Although the newly proposed model is very simple, it offers a modular, computationally efficient, and effective alternative to other building recognition techniques. According to a comparison of experimental results with the state-of-the-art building recognition systems, it is shown that the newly proposed SFBR model can obtain very satisfactory recognition accuracy despite its simplicity.
